Saumur-Champigny is one of the Loire’s great reds. Château de Villeneuve makes three versions: this one Vieilles Vignes and Grand Clos. Jean-Pierre Chevallier – the estate’s fourth-generation winemaker – will only release Vieilles Vignes and Grand Clos when the quality is exceptional. That means that the classic domaine red this one often includes grapes from his best sites.

This organic and vegan-friendly red is made from Cabernet Franc grapes that are picked by hand from roughly 45-year-old vines. Matured in a combo of wooden vats concrete and stainless steel this juicy wine tastes like blackberries foraged from leafy hedgerows raspberry cherry pepper and smoky herbs like the waft of rosemary as you take the roast lamb out of the oven. It’s a wonderful alternative to Pinot Noir and can be sipped lightly chilled with barbeques in the summer or at room temperature with roasts stews and grills over the winter. This great value bottle will also continue to improve in the cellar for at least five years from the vintage maybe even more.

If you can avoid the allure of the region’s multiple mushroom museums head east along the Loire out of Saumur and you’ll discover Château de Villeneuve – one of an embarrassment of stunning properties in the area. This family-run estate has been making wine since 1577. With only 25 hectares of vines their wines are a rare treat to stumble across.
